Transaction e3f5812424b77d5117558c925160cb91689e3437c1b0c0c0246e928488d8623a

1 Input
2 Outputs
  • e3f5812424b77d5117558c925160cb91689e3437c1b0c0c0246e928488d8623a:0
  • value  2546041
    address  1KDTgjceV5tPyP91qpcK73RqHWQd1yz5rq
  • e3f5812424b77d5117558c925160cb91689e3437c1b0c0c0246e928488d8623a:1
  • value  45441926
    address  12LQDXSETVe18sbRSvabgVuF1Nh6ArT4KH